From 6a55a11f555095421f42f862b8a7f5bddf0562e6 Mon Sep 17 00:00:00 2001 From: Mohamad Date: Fri, 1 Jul 2022 17:05:40 +0200 Subject: [PATCH] set python_version env var before running createadmin --- roles/lokole/tasks/setup.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/roles/lokole/tasks/setup.yml b/roles/lokole/tasks/setup.yml index 3c5b71b7c..a8542f90b 100644 --- a/roles/lokole/tasks/setup.yml +++ b/roles/lokole/tasks/setup.yml @@ -6,6 +6,7 @@ - name: Create Lokole admin user with password, for http://box{{ lokole_url }} # http://box/lokole shell: | while read envvar; do export "$envvar"; done < {{ lokole_run_dir }}/settings.env + python_version=$(python3 -c 'from sys import version_info; print("%s.%s" % (version_info.major, version_info.minor));';) cd {{ lokole_venv }}/lib/python${python_version}/site-packages/ export FLASK_APP="opwen_email_client.webapp:app" {{ lokole_venv }}/bin/flask manage createadmin --name='{{ lokole_admin_user }}' --password='{{ lokole_admin_password }}'